How do I accurately calculate the required scent coverage area for my hotel lobby and select a commercial fragrance machine with appropriate capacity without oversaturating or underscenting?

Accurately determining the required scent coverage is paramount for effective aroma marketing without overwhelming or underwhelming guests. Generic square footage recommendations often fall short. The key is to calculate the volumetric space, considering not just floor area but also ceiling height and air exchange rates.

  1. Volumetric Calculation: Measure the length, width, and height of the space in meters (or feet) to get the cubic meters (CBM) or cubic feet (CF). For example, a lobby 20m x 15m with a 5m ceiling height is 1500 CBM.

  2. Air Exchange Rates: Hotels, especially those with high foot traffic or open-plan designs, have significant air exchange rates due to doors opening, HVAC systems, and ventilation. A space with high air exchange will require a more powerful large-area aroma diffuser or a higher intensity setting to maintain consistent scent.

  3. Space Characteristics: Open-plan areas, high ceilings, and spaces with soft furnishings (carpets, drapery) absorb scent, potentially requiring more robust scent delivery systems. Conversely, enclosed spaces or those with hard surfaces might need less.

  4. Machine Capacity Ratings: Commercial fragrance machines are typically rated in CBM or square meters (sqm). Always compare your calculated CBM to the machine's CBM capacity. If only sqm is provided, assume a standard ceiling height (e.g., 3m) to convert to CBM. For instance, a machine rated for 500 sqm (at 3m height) covers 1500 CBM.

  5. Adjustable Intensity: Crucially, select a machine with programmable intensity settings. This allows you to fine-tune the scent output based on real-time feedback, time of day, or occupancy levels, preventing both oversaturation and underscenting. It's always advisable to choose a machine with a slightly higher capacity than your minimum requirement to allow for flexibility and future adjustments.

Beyond basic cold air diffusion, what are the actual performance differences and maintenance implications between advanced nebulization, dry air, and HVAC-integrated commercial fragrance machines for a luxury hotel environment?

While 'cold air diffusion' is a broad term, understanding the nuances of different technologies is vital for a luxury hotel. The gold standard for professional scenting equipment in commercial settings is nebulization, a form of cold air diffusion.

  1. Nebulization (Cold Air Diffusion): This technology uses highly pressurized air to break down fragrance oil into a fine, dry mist of nanoparticles. There's no heat, no water, and no alcohol involved, preserving the therapeutic and aromatic integrity of the oils. The result is a pure, consistent, and long-lasting scent. Performance is superior for large areas and luxury environments due to the fine, even dispersion and lack of residue. Maintenance involves periodic cleaning of the atomizer nozzle (often with alcohol) and regular oil refills. Lifespan is excellent with proper care.

  2. Dry Air Diffusion: Less common for pure liquid fragrance oils, some 'dry air' systems use pre-impregnated cartridges or pads. While simple, they often offer less control over intensity, can have a shorter scent throw, and the scent profile might degrade faster. They are generally suited for smaller, less demanding applications. Maintenance is minimal, typically just cartridge replacement.

  3. HVAC-Integrated Systems: These are typically advanced nebulization units designed to connect directly to a hotel's heating,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C) system. This method offers the most uniform ambient scent delivery across vast, multi-zone areas. The scent is dispersed directly into the airflow, ensuring consistent distribution without visible diffusers. Performance is unparalleled for comprehensive hotel scenting. Maintenance involves regular oil changes and periodic inspection/cleaning of the unit, often requiring access to the HVAC ductwork. They are ideal for achieving seamless scent branding throughout a property.

For a luxury hotel, advanced nebulization, especially when HVAC scent diffuser integrated, offers the best performance, consistency, and discreet operation, aligning perfectly with high-end guest expectations.

What specific criteria should hotels use to evaluate the safety, longevity, and impact of different fragrance oils for commercial use, especially concerning guest allergies and regulatory compliance?

Choosing the right fragrance oil is as critical as selecting the machine itself, particularly when considering guest well-being and regulatory adherence.

  1. Safety & Certification (IFRA): The most crucial criterion is compliance with the International Fragrance Association (IFRA) Standards. IFRA sets global guidelines for the safe use of fragrance ingredients, based on scientific evidence. Always choose suppliers whose oils are IFRA-certified, ensuring they are safe for inhalation and skin contact (even indirect). Request Safety Data Sheets (SDS) for all oils, which provide detailed information on ingredients, handling, and potential hazards.

  2. Quality & Purity: High-quality fragrance oils are typically blends of natural essential oils and synthetic aroma chemicals, formulated for stability and longevity. Pure essential oils are natural but can be more volatile, expensive, and may have stronger allergenic potential for some. Avoid oils with high alcohol content or cheap diluents, as these can degrade quickly and potentially damage diffusion equipment.

  3. Longevity & Stability: A good commercial fragrance oil should maintain its scent profile consistently over time without quickly fading or changing. This is influenced by the quality of ingredients and the formulation. Reputable suppliers will offer oils designed for sustained release through cold air diffusion technology.

  4. Guest Allergies: While IFRA standards address general safety, individual allergies are a concern. Hotels should inquire about the common allergens present in specific oils (e.g., limonene, linalool, geraniol). While it's impossible to cater to every allergy, choosing oils with fewer known common allergens or offering a variety of scent profiles (e.g., natural, hypoallergenic options) can mitigate risk. Transparency by displaying a general scent profile or providing information upon request is a best practice.

  5. Regulatory Compliance: Beyond IFRA, ensure oils comply with local health, safety, and environmental regulations. This includes proper storage, handling, and disposal of oils. In some regions, certain chemicals may be restricted. Always partner with a supplier knowledgeable in these regulations.

What are the common installation challenges and best practices for integrating a commercial fragrance machine into existing hotel HVAC systems, particularly in older buildings, to ensure even scent distribution and minimal disruption?

Integrating a HVAC scent diffuser into an existing system, especially in older buildings, presents unique challenges that require careful planning and professional execution.

  1. Ductwork Assessment:

    • Challenge: Older buildings may have outdated, corroded, or asbestos-containing ductwork. The size, material, and condition of ducts can impact airflow and scent distribution. Identifying optimal injection points without interfering with existing HVAC sensors or dampers is crucial.
    • Best Practice: Conduct a thorough HVAC system survey by a qualified technician. Identify main supply air ducts, avoiding return air ducts where scent could be diluted or filtered out prematurely. Ensure the chosen injection point is upstream of any filters that could remove scent particles.
  2. Airflow Dynamics:

    • Challenge: Uneven airflow, dead spots, or excessive turbulence within the ductwork can lead to inconsistent scent distribution or rapid dissipation.
    • Best Practice: Strategic placement of the scent injection nozzle is key. It should be in a section of the duct with consistent, laminar airflow to ensure even mixing. Sometimes, multiple smaller injection points or standalone units for specific zones might be more effective than a single large unit attempting to cover a complex, multi-zone HVAC system.
  3. Power and Accessibility:

    • Challenge: Finding suitable power outlets near the HVAC unit and ensuring the scent machine is accessible for maintenance (oil refills, cleaning) can be difficult in confined spaces or older infrastructure.
    • Best Practice: Plan for dedicated power supply if necessary. Ensure the unit is installed in an easily accessible location for servicing, even if it means slightly longer tubing to the injection point. Consider remote monitoring and control capabilities for easier management.
  4. Noise and Vibration:

    • Challenge: Some commercial fragrance machines, particularly older or lower-quality models, can produce noise or vibration that transmits through the ductwork, disrupting guest tranquility.
    • Best Practice: Choose high-quality professional scenting equipment known for quiet operation. Install vibration dampeners if needed. Ensure the unit is securely mounted and isolated from the ductwork to prevent noise transfer.
  5. Disruption:

    • Challenge: Installation can be disruptive to hotel operations and guests.
    • Best Practice: Schedule installation during off-peak hours or when specific areas are less occupied. Work with experienced installers who understand the need for minimal intrusion in a hospitality environment. Communicate clearly with hotel staff about the process.

How can a hotel practically measure the return on investment (ROI) of a commercial fragrance machine, beyond anecdotal feedback, in terms of guest satisfaction, loyalty, and potential revenue uplift?

Measuring the ROI of aroma marketing systems moves beyond subjective opinions to quantifiable metrics, demonstrating its value as a strategic investment.

  1. Guest Satisfaction Scores (GSS): Monitor GSS related to overall ambiance, comfort, and cleanliness before and after implementing the hotel scenting solution. Look for increases in scores, especially those directly or indirectly influenced by sensory experience. Many guests may not explicitly mention scent but will rate the overall 'feel' of the hotel higher.

  2. Online Reviews and Social Media Mentions: Analyze guest reviews on platforms like TripAdvisor, Google, and social media for mentions of the hotel's 'smell,' 'freshness,' 'welcoming atmosphere,' or 'unique ambiance.' Track the frequency and sentiment of these mentions. A positive shift indicates enhanced guest experience enhancement.

  3. Dwell Time and Engagement: For common areas like lobbies, bars, or retail spaces within the hotel, observe or measure average dwell time. Studies (e.g., by Dr. Alan Hirsch) have shown that pleasant scents can increase perceived dwell time and encourage exploration. Increased dwell time can correlate with higher F&B sales or retail purchases.

  4. Repeat Bookings and Loyalty Program Enrollment: While harder to directly attribute solely to scent, a holistic positive guest experience, including scent, contributes to loyalty. Track repeat booking rates and new enrollments in loyalty programs. Compare these trends before and after scent implementation.

  5. Staff Morale and Productivity: A pleasant work environment, influenced by ambient scent delivery, can improve staff morale, reduce stress, and potentially increase productivity. While difficult to quantify directly, survey staff for feedback on their workplace environment.

  6. Brand Perception and Differentiation: Scent creates a powerful, subconscious connection to a brand. While intangible, this contributes to a hotel's unique selling proposition. Conduct brand perception surveys or focus groups to assess how the scent contributes to brand recall and differentiation from competitors. For instance, a signature scent can become as recognizable as a logo, fostering stronger brand loyalty.

  7. Occupancy Rates and ADR (Average Daily Rate): Over time, if the scent strategy contributes significantly to positive guest experiences and reviews, it can indirectly support higher occupancy rates and potentially justify an increase in Average Daily Rate, as the perceived value of the stay increases.

What are the specific long-term maintenance schedules, common troubleshooting tips, and expected lifespan of high-end commercial fragrance machines to ensure consistent performance and minimize operational costs?

Ensuring the longevity and consistent performance of your commercial fragrance machine requires adherence to a structured maintenance schedule and knowing how to address common issues.

  1. Long-Term Maintenance Schedules:

    • Daily/Weekly: Monitor oil levels. Most programmable scent machines have timers, but a quick visual check ensures you don't run out unexpectedly. Ensure the machine is running according to its programmed schedule.
    • Monthly: Refill fragrance oil as needed. Check for any leaks around the oil bottle or connections. Wipe down the exterior of the unit.
    • Quarterly (or every 3-4 oil changes): Clean the atomizer/nozzle. This is critical for cold air diffusion technology. Use a small amount of isopropyl alcohol (70% or higher) in an empty oil bottle, run the machine for 15-30 minutes, then replace with fragrance oil. This prevents residue buildup that can clog the nozzle and reduce scent output. Check air filters if your model has them.
    • Annually: Professional inspection and deep cleaning. A technician can inspect internal components, check for wear and tear, and ensure all connections are secure. This is especially important for HVAC scent diffuser systems.
  2. Common Troubleshooting Tips:

    • Weak or No Scent:
      • Check Oil Level: The most common reason. Refill immediately.
      • Clogged Nozzle: Perform the quarterly alcohol cleaning procedure.
      • Incorrect Settings: Verify the intensity and operating schedule on the aromatherapy machine's control panel.
      • Airflow Obstruction: Ensure the machine's air intake/output is not blocked.
    • Machine Not Running:
      • Power Supply: Check if it's plugged in and the power outlet is functional.
      • Timer Settings: Ensure the timer is programmed correctly and not set to 'off'.
      • Safety Sensors: Some machines have tilt or low-oil sensors that can shut them off.
    • Leaking Oil:
      • Loose Bottle/Connections: Tighten the oil bottle securely. Check all tubing connections.
      • Damaged Seal: Inspect the seal on the oil bottle or atomizer head for cracks or wear. Replace if necessary.
      • Overfilling: Avoid overfilling the oil bottle beyond the recommended level.
  3. Expected Lifespan & Operational Costs:
    High-quality commercial fragrance machines from reputable manufacturers are built for durability and can last 5-10+ years with proper maintenance. Some robust models, especially those designed for heavy commercial use, can exceed this. Operational costs primarily involve the consistent purchase of fragrance oil and occasional replacement parts (e.g., atomizer heads, filters) over its lifespan. By adhering to the maintenance schedule and using manufacturer-recommended oils, hotels can minimize unexpected breakdowns and ensure a low total cost of ownership.

How long can a dry battery last and how to replace it?

Battery life varies depending on the frequency and position of use. In general, a new dry battery can last 1-2 months. To replace the battery, open the battery cover of the fragrance machine and install the new battery according to the positive and negative polarity.

How long can a fragrance machine last when filled with essential oil at a time?​

The duration of use is related to the gear setting. Under low gear, 15ML essential oil can be used for about 1-2 weeks; under high gear, the use time is about 3-5 days. Please refer to the actual use for the specific duration.
